2009 Chrysler Voyager — MOT failures & pass rate

Across 640 MOT tests, the 2009 Chrysler Voyager recorded a 70.9% pass rate. That is 2.1 percentage points worse than MPVs of a similar age, which fail at 27.0%. Failures cluster in lighting & signalling, brakes and suspension.

What the MOT record shows

No single area dominates — lighting & signalling (18.9%) and brakes (17.5%) are close, so failures are spread across several systems rather than one weak point.

At component level the recurring items are rbt (sp), stop lamp and position lamp — rbt (sp) alone was recorded 64 times.

Mileage matters less than usual here: the 2009 Voyager fails 25.9% of the time in the 30-60k band and 26.8% at 150k+, a spread of only 0.9 points.

Brakes is the most common advisory, noted on 32.7% of tests — work that passed today but is likely due soon.

The trend is worsening — 27.4% of tests failed in 2021 against 29.7% in 2025, the usual pattern as a fleet ages.

Top failure categories

Most common MOT failure areas — 2009 Chrysler Voyager
# Category % of tests affected Tests
1 Lighting & signalling 18.9% 121
2 Brakes 17.5% 112
3 Suspension 8.8% 56
4 Emissions & environmental 6.1% 39
5 Body, structure & corrosion 5.3% 34
6 Visibility 4.2% 27
Share of tests failing on each category Lighting & signalling 18.9% Brakes 17.5% Suspension 8.8% Emissions & environmental 6.1% Body, structure & corrosion 5.3% Visibility 4.2%
Percentage of tests with at least one failure recorded in each category.
